Adam Williams wrote:
> Hi, I know its not recommended to use yum to upgrade from FC1 to FC2,
> and that anaconda should be used. I have a remote server though, and
> I'd like to attempt to use yum to upgrade it from FC1 to FC2. Does
> anyone have any instructions on how to do this? I put on the fedocra
> core 2 release and fedora core 2's yum noarch RPMs and then tried yum
> -y update and yum -y upgrade, but both return dependancy errors on
> MySQL (i'm using mysql 4.0.1 rpms from mysql.com) any suggestions,
> thanks?
>
>
Adam,
If you get any dependency problem, just remove the package. For your
case, what you need to do is 'rpm -e --nodeps mysql'. Then you run 'yum
-y upgrade'. I believe there are more dependency problems, just remove
all of them and give it a try.
